Seriously, what could be said about Hot Toy's Movie Masterpiece 1/6th-scaled BATMOBILE [www] aka The TUMBLER? [tagged] Ever since this beatie made it's official debut at the recent Tokyo Toy Show (circa June 19-22) - fans have been clamoring for further details, specifically it's price - becoz simply, tis ain't no toddler-toy - and from these released images, it is mofo-awesome looking, complete with opening cockpit and light-up functions (and no, the figure DOES NOT come with the vehicle LOL). Slated for a December-release, Blister.jp currently has it priced at 49,000YEN (US$460 / SGD$627). FYI: it is stated that this item is for sale only in Hong Kong and Japan.

Special features include:

- Authentically detailed 1/6th scale model car
- Perfect scale to Hot Toys 1/6th scale Batman (the Original costume) collectible figure.
- Headlights light up function
- Cockpit/roof opening panel - slides up and down gives the 1/6th scale Batman access
- Movable breaking flaps
- Made of plastic
